LEGAL PRACTITIONERS ACT 1981 - SECT 65

65—Rights of the Society

        (1)         Subject to this section, where the Society has made any payment to a claimant under this Part, the Society is, to the extent of the payment, subrogated to the rights of the claimant against any person liable at law or in equity for the fiduciary or professional default in respect of which the payment was made.

        (2)         This section does not confer on the Society any right to recover money from a person whose liability in respect of a fiduciary or professional default does not arise from a wrongful or negligent act or omission on that person's part.
